Transaction 390664a0eed532d81a4123908a93a53bb78b39afb3a28bd3470ccd700b9ccd55
3 Input
2 Outputs
- 390664a0eed532d81a4123908a93a53bb78b39afb3a28bd3470ccd700b9ccd55:0
- 390664a0eed532d81a4123908a93a53bb78b39afb3a28bd3470ccd700b9ccd55:1
value 5500000
address 1H5R847AT2qWjPpye9ux1g4nafam9KcTXU
value 1022956
address 18BWuZWPRSvJAYwHacSXpyjtvA7nE6rTmU